HONOR X6a, X5 Plus Arrive In Malaysia; Available From RM449

Both phones come with a big battery.

HONOR has released two new phones from its X series into the Malaysian market. The X6a and X5 Plus are entry-level devices that, on paper at least, offer amazing specs for these price segments.

X6a

The X6a was introduced just last month, sporting a 6.56-inch 720p display with a 90Hz refresh rate. It is driven by a MediaTek Helio G36 chipset with 6GB of RAM and 128GB of expandable storage.

On the back, it features a 50MP main camera, a macro lens, and a depth sensor, while the display holds 5MP selfie snapper. Powering it is a 5,200mAh battery with support for 22.5W charging.

X5 Plus

Even more affordable is the X5 Plus, which is equipped with the same 6.56-inch 720p display at 90Hz. Another similarity with the X6a is that it also runs on a MediaTek Helio G36 SoC, paired with only 4GB of RAM and a paltry 64GB of storage that can be expanded via a microSD card.

It uses a 50MP primary rear camera alongside a depth sensor and the front houses a 5MP selfie shooter. Furthermore, it is powered by a 5,200mAh battery with 10W charging. Despite being under RM500, the phone still comes with a USB-C charging sport, albeit with USB 2.0 speeds.

Both phones support dual-SIM with 4G, Wi-Fi 5, and Bluetooth 5.1, although NFC support seems to be missing. The budget devices even come with the standard 3.5mm headphone jack.

For pricing, the X5 Plus retails for RM449 while the X6a can be purchased for RM599. They are available nationwide on the brand’s online store.
